Cortland fire chief to receive Career Fire Chief of the Year award

CORTLAND, NY (607NewsNow) — Cortland’s fire chief is getting an award. 

Chief Wayne Friedman will be presented with the Career Fire Chief of the Year award by the New York State Association of Fire Chiefs.

“This distinguished recognition reflects Chief Friedman’s exceptional leadership, unwavering commitment to public safety, and dedicated service to the fire service profession,” Mayor Scott Steve said. “Throughout his tenure, Chief Friedman has demonstrated outstanding professionalism, operational excellence, and a steadfast commitment to the residents and visitors of the City of Cortland.”

The award presentation is June 11 at The Oncenter in Syracuse.
